The next time you will switch on again the receiver, the working mode and data-link will be the
last selected.
If you prefer, you can select the correct data-link by handheld software.
As regards the advanced working parameters, for instance sampling interval, minimum
elevation angle, antenna height, etc, they can be set by handheld software or by Assistant,
without modifying the parameters the receiver will work with default parameters.
The static mode parameters cannot be selected by the controller, but only by Assistant.
